Business License

Anyone involved in business activities within the City of Medicine Hat requires a Business License.

Once you receive your City Business License, it must be prominently displayed in your place of business.

How long will it take?

A typical new business license will be processed within 5-15 business days. However, it may take longer if other types of permits, review and/or approvals are needed. In certain circumstances, this may include a building permit, zoning approval, other external approvals, or MPC review.

How much will it cost?

The fee to apply for a business license will vary depending on the circumstances, including:

  • In-town business (resident) or out-of-town business (non-resident)
  • Commercial location or Home location
  • Type of business: e.g. Hotel, Retail store, Contractor, Photographer (to name a few)

After your Business License application is received and processed, you will be notified of the application fee.

If you do business within the City of Medicine Hat and make a profit, you require a Business License.

Even if you hold a Provincial License with the Province of Alberta you are still required to hold a local license from the City of Medicine Hat in order to conduct your business legally inside the corporate limits of Medicine Hat.

Refer to Bylaw 2339, Section 3.

'Exempt' professionals

Certain professional businesses (i.e. dentists, lawyers, engineers, architects) are not required to pay for a business license in the City of Medicine Hat. However, such businesses must still apply for a business license to ensure allowable land use, for disclosure of their business location, and to ensure that other conditions are met. This payment exception applies to members of any professional association regulated by members of their own profession pursuant to a provincial statute.

Refer to Bylaw 2339, Section 4(c).

You may choose a one-year or three-year option when you apply.

The typical option is a yearly Business License. Expiry is one calendar year after the date it was issued. Another option is a three-year Business License. For both, renewal notices are mailed 30 days in advance of expiration.

If you plan to move your business, please notify Planning and Development Services before the move occurs. It may be a simple administrative change, or it may require a review to determine if your type of business activity is permitted in the area.

If you purchased an existing business, you must obtain a new Business License. Contact Planning and Development Services and provide proof of transfer of ownership (typically bill of sale) showing business description and names of buyer and seller.

If you close or sell your business, please notify Planning and Development Services so your license file can be closed. License fees already paid are not refundable. If you sell your business, the new owner must apply for a new Business License, and potentially, other approvals will also be required.

Organizer

A Business License is required if you are the organizer of a trade show, farmers' market or similar event.


Participant

Participants are not required to obtain an individual Business License.

Non-profit organizations operating in Medicine Hat require a Business License. You will be asked to provide verification of your non-profit status.

Charitable organizations undertaking fundraising activities in Medicine Hat are not required to pay for a business license in the City of Medicine Hat.

If operating from a commercial location, you must still apply for a business license to ensure allowable land use, for disclosure of their business location, and to ensure that other conditions are met.
